Ingredients for 3-4 servings:
chicken minced meat 1 pack. (500 g)
breadcrumbs 30 g (approximately 2 tablespoons)
butter 50 g
salt to taste
pepper to taste
fresh parsley
1 clove fresh garlic
milk 40 ml
Dijon mustard 30 g
cream 30% 2 bottles (380 g)
cheddar cheese 100 g
tomato paste 10 g
1 onion
Preparation:
Step 1
Take the butter out of the refrigerator about 15 minutes before cooking to soften it. Put the minced meat in a bowl. Finely chop the parsley and garlic, add to the bowl with the minced meat. Pour the breadcrumbs there.
Step 2
Salt, pepper and pour milk.
Step 3
Add the softened butter. Mix until the components are combined.
Step 4
Peel the onion and cut it into thin half rings. Place the onion in a blender glass and grind until smooth. Transfer to a bowl.
Step 5
Add cream, tomato paste, Dijon mustard, salt and pepper to the onion. Stir.
Step 6
Grate the cheese on a coarse grater, add to the sauce and mix.
Step 7
Using a tablespoon with wet hands, shape the minced meat into meatballs with a diameter of about 5 cm. Place in a baking dish.
Step 8
Pour the dumplings with sauce. Cover the form with foil in 2 layers and bake in an oven heated to 180 °C for 10 minutes. Then remove the foil and bake for another 5 minutes.
